Daily Press Briefing by the Office of the Spokesperson for the Secretary-General

The Secretary-General has expressed concerns about reports of the Israeli Government authorizing the declaration of 370 acres in the West Bank, as so-called "State land".  He said that settlement activities are a violation of international law, running counter to Government pronouncements supporting a two-State solution.

Secretary-General Announces First Members of High-level Advisory Group for Every Woman Every Child

SG/A/1629-WOM/2056

United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on today announced the first members of the High-level Advisory Group for Every Woman Every Child, who will help provide leadership and inspire actions for women’s, children’s and adolescents’ health in the transition from the Millennium Development Goals to the universal Sustainable Development Goals agenda.
